The role

As a Positive Behaviour Support Worker at Quo Vadis Trust (QVT), you will support adults with a range of mental health needs, including anxiety, depression, bipolar disorder, substance misuse, and challenges engaging with services. You will manage and key-work a caseload, supporting individuals to move forward, build independence, and re-engage with their communities.

This role is hands-on and relationship-led. You will complete assessments, support inductions into services, and work closely with clients to agree clear support plans and measurable goals. You will also provide practical guidance around housing, welfare, and benefits, supporting clients through transitions and move-on planning.


Key Responsibilities:

  • Provide a responsive, client-focused service to an allocated caseload
  • Build effective working relationships and support individual recovery goals
  • Develop and review support plans with clear, measurable outcomes
  • Complete inductions, risk assessments, and ongoing reviews
  • Manage incidents and challenging behavior using de-escalation techniques
  • Maintain accurate records using the client management system
  • Prepare reports and updates as required
  • Carry out property, room, and health and safety checks
  • Support move-ins, move-outs, and daily living activities
  • Encourage clients with housekeeping and independent living skills
  • Work collaboratively with colleagues, external agencies, and healthcare professionals
  • Provide cover across QVT schemes when required
